Written by James T. Baker, this primary sourcebook, includes the major documents that illustrate the development of religion in and its impact on United States history. These primary sourcebooks include the major documents that illustrate the development of religion and its impact on U.S. history. Encouraging students to explore the varieties, developments, similarities, and differences of religion in the United States, RELIGION IN AMERICA sheds light on certain religious contradictions in the American personality. Each volume considers the contradictions resulting from two great historical events that shook the Western world just as Europeans began arriving in America: the Reformation and the Enlightenment.
